Crime Alert (CLERY) (back to this year's index)
Strong Arm Robbery
UCPD crime report # 12-00373

People's Park
January 26, 2012

On Wednesday, January 25, 2012 at approximately 8:55 p.m. a local emergency room reported to UCPD that they were treating a victim of a strong arm robbery which had occurred earlier in the day in People’s Park.  At approximately 2:00 p.m. the victim, a nonaffiliated 43 year old man, was sitting down and eating his lunch near the basketball courts when six unknown males approached him and asked him for money.  The victim told them he didn’t have any money.  The suspects proceeded to kick and punch the victim repeatedly in the ribs, face, neck and back and took his personal property.  The suspects left the park in an unknown direction.  The victim was treated for his injuries.

The suspects are described as:

Suspect #1 – A White male, with long hair and unshaven.

 Suspect #2 – A Hispanic male, with short hair wearing a red tank top.

Suspects #3-#6 – Unknown male suspects.
